    Demand and Supply are important concepts in Economics. In fact they form the foundations for the subject of Economics.

    Demand is basically defined as the ability and willingness of a person to purchase a product in a particular time. On the other hand, Supply is the willingness and ability of a manufacturer or supplier to supply a good for sale in the market in a specific time frame.

    Demand of goods depends on income, taste, prices, population, substitute products, complimentary goods etc.
